Things to Do in Avondale, Jacksonville
A historic neighborhood bordering Riverside with tree-lined streets, antique shops, independent restaurants, and a walkable stretch along St. Johns Ave that draws locals all week long.

Parks & Green Spaces
Boone Park
A large neighborhood park with a disc golf course, picnic shelters, and a winding trail through the woods.
Fishweir Park
A neighborhood park named after Fishweir Creek with basketball courts, multi-use fields, a softball field, and a recently updated playground.
